Preserve Your Irrigation Sprinklers in Tip-Top Shape

To secure the longevity of your irrigation sprinklers, scheduled maintenance is key. Start by inspecting your sprinkler system at least once a month for any signs of damage or leaks. Thoroughly scrub the sprinkler heads with a tool to get rid of debris and mineral buildup. Consider applying a soft cleaning solution if necessary. Ensure that all sprinkler heads are aligned correctly to deliver water evenly across your lawn.

  • Inspect the pressure control periodically to maintain optimal water pressure.
  • Flush your sprinkler system in the fall to prevent freeze damage during winter months.
  • Seek out a professional irrigation specialist for any repairs or maintenance tasks you are uncomfortable to handle yourself.
